titleOfInvention | Hot-dip galvanized steel sheet with excellent surface appearance |
abstract | An object of the present invention is to provide a hot dip galvanized steel sheet having an excellent surface appearance without causing non-plating even when an easily oxidizable element is contained in the steel sheet base material. SOLUTION: A hot dip galvanized steel sheet containing one or more elements that are more easily oxidized than Fe in a steel sheet base material in a total amount of 0.5% by mass or more and 5% by mass or less, comprising a steel plate base material and a plating layer. A hot-dip galvanized steel sheet having an excellent surface appearance, wherein the maximum diameter of a non-reactive region existing at an interface is 60 μm or less. [Selection figure] None |
